(Nicolas) Bilbo Baggins impressions

When we're introduced to Bilbo Baggins we see that he is a very gentlemanly type of character because he acts fancy and well mannered. In the beginning of the book he is shown off as the person who is rich and tidy of his house like he is his own butler of some sorts. He is always wanting everything to look nice and doesn't like change,  I noticed this when Gandolf came to his house and asked him if he wanted to go on an adventure. Bilbo Baggins is the kind of person that likes a scheduled/ linear day, one that has consistency or has been planned which gives the second point of the tidy personality. In the beginning of the book we see that he lives alone in what is called a hobbit-hole in a small village, but what is interesting is that he has such an unnecessarily large house because when the 14 dwarves stay the night he has enough rooms for all of them.
